The other day was with my Venezuelan friends around Soho, and looking for a place to eat and drink something we decided to go to Boheme Bar and Kitchen. Quite a strange decor for a bar but as it’s in the middle of Soho that wouldn’t surprise. Offering British food with American and European influence according to their web site. They have starters going from mini burgers, to nachos, also goat cheese and tomato bruschetta, and as main some salads, a pulled pork sandwich, chilli dogs, cheeseburgers, macaroni and cheese, fish and chips, baby back ribs, grill steaks and fishes.

Saw a couple options I want it to try in the menu, but as I was the only one eating I had to reduce my selection to two, first jalapeno chipolatas, which is a kind of spicy small sausages with jalapeno peppers and some sort of tomato chutney, and as a second I played safe and went for a New York Chicken Blue Cheese salad.

The chipolatas were ok, not completely sure with the chutney combination and the jalapeno peppers, the salad quite simple grilled chicken, lettuce, croutons, and blue cheese, nothing special.

They got a selection of cocktails, which are apparently good, so I would stick to the drinking in BBK with some nibbles.
